How We Extract Water from Your Hardwood Floors
Our team follows a specific process to ensure that your hardwood floors are dried and restored to their original condition. We use specialized equipment to extract the water, and then we’ll assess the moisture levels in your floors to find out the best course of action for drying and restoration. This process typically takes 3-5 days, dep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area.
Step 1: Water Extraction
We’ll use a combination of pumps and wet vacuums to extract as much water as possible from your hardwood floors. This process typically takes 1-2 hours, depending on the amount of water present.
Step 2: Moisture Assessment
Our team will use specialized equipment to assess the moisture levels in your floors. This will help us find out the best course of action for drying and restoration.
Step 3: Drying
We’ll use specialized equipment to dry your hardwood floors, including air movers and dehumidifiers. This process typically takes 2-3 days, dep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area.
Step 4: Restoration
Once your floors are dry, we’ll work with you to develop a customized plan to restore your floors to their original beauty. This may include refinishing or replacing damaged boards.

Warning Signs You Need Hardwood Floor Water Extraction
Catching these sign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ems down the road. Don’t ignore these warning signs – call us now to schedule your appointment.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a musty smell coming from your hardwood floors, it’s a sign that water has seeped into the wood. This can lead to further damage and costly repairs if left untreated.
Warped or Buckled Boards
If your hardwood boards are warped or buckled, it’s a sign that water has caused damage to the wood. This can be a costly repair if left untreated.
Discoloration or Staining
If your hardwood floors are discolored or stained, it’s a sign that water has caused damage to the wood. This can be a costly repair if left untreated.
Soft or Spongy Floors
If your hardwood floors feel soft or spongy to the touch, it’s a sign that water has caused damage to the wood. This can be a costly repair if left untreated.
Water Stains or Rings
If you notice water stains or rings on your hardwood floors, it’s a sign that water has seeped into the wood. This can lead to further damage and costly repairs if left untreated.
